| The main weakness with the playoff season is that in the end the whole season up to the penultimate week comes down to one thing: creating four teams for a semi final > final situation as in any Cup.
The advantage of finishing top four rather than fifth to eighth is that you get a 'second chance' in the playoffs. But if you win your first playoff, you lose the right to a second chance.
Wigan have done exactly what we did last year - top the league, then play a storming game in the first playoff then that's it you are into one slip and you're gone territory.
So the full season apart from two weeks is about turning 14 into 4, then who are deemed Champions and who are deemed Bottlers comes down to fitness, form and luck in a two week window of the season.
